Conservative Management of Fetus Papyraceus
2016
Journal of Case Reports
Fetus papyraceus also known as fetal resorption, is the term used to describe a mummified fetus in multigestation pregnancy where one fetus dies and is compressed between the membranes of the living fetus and the uterine wall. Though the complications in affected pregnancy can be severe, we report successful conservative management of fetus papyraceus. Careful monitoring is required during pregnancy for its successful outcome.
